How To Avoid Fatigue In Summer
Have you ever experienced fatigue in summer? Well, the heat can simply drain your energy levels. What causes fatigue in the summer? Well, the hot climate is enough to stress up your body in various levels.

Apart from the heat, there are some other factors which make us feel tired during summer. Pollution, swimming in the pools, breathing toxic air are some other factors that contribute to the fatigue.
Drinking enough water, avoiding caffeinated beverages and avoiding sun exposure can help you overcome fatigue in summer.
How To Avoid Muscle Cramps In Summer
Passing each day with an exhausted body can really be hell during this hot season. Exhaustion, sleeplessness, loss of appetite, headache and body pains are some of the summer fatigue symptoms.
Now, let us discuss how to avoid fatigue in summer.

Temperatures
It goes without saying that hot climate saps your energy levels. Your body struggles a lot to cool your system down and this will release cortisol in your body due to the stress. Try drinking water and chewing mint leaves in order to help your body prevent the fatigue.

Stress-levels
Try to keep yourself away from stress as much as possible as your body naturally has a lot to deal with during summers.

Cotton Clothes
As said earlier, fatigue can be caused due to the temperatures. So, wear cotton clothes to help your body cope up with the hot climate.

Swimming Pools
Do you enjoy swimming? Then this tip is for you. A study revealed that the chlorine content in the pools can be one of the reasons behind the fatigue you experience after coming home. To avoid this, you can use a cream on your skin which blocks the chlorine absorption.

Carrots
Enjoy carrot juice often in summers as it helps you relax. When your body is tired, it needs a chances to relax well.

Avoid Sun
If you are suffering from any ailments or chronic problems, it is advisable to avoid exposing yourself to hot climates.

Indoor Plants
In summer, most of us rely on air-conditioners to cool our indoors. But these cooling machines release certain chemicals in the air and this can also be one of the reasons for fatigue in summer. Try some indoor plants that purify the air.

Vanilla Ice Cream
If you love ice cream, go for the vanilla flavour. It can boost your energy levels and help you overcome fatigue temporarily. But don't over eat those ice creams as they add up to your calories.
